Law Yi Chun (羅以臻)
3×3 · top 1.7% of 284,439 all-time · competing since March 2023 · 2023CHUN04
Law Yi Chun (羅以臻) has been competing for 4 years. His best event is the 3×3: a personal-best single of 7.31, set at Mississauga Newcomers A 2025, puts him in the top 1.7% of the 284,439 people who have ever been ranked in the event, and 39th in Hong Kong, China. Until July 2008, no official 3×3 solve in the world had been that fast. Across 12 competitions since March 2023, he has put 226 official solves on the record across seven events. Solve to solve, his 3×3 times vary about 14% around a typical one; 68% of the 35,811 competitors with ten or more counted rounds hold a tighter spread. His 3×3 best has come down from 15.77 in March 2023 to 7.31, a 54% improvement. Law has entered twelve competitions, more competitions than 94% of everyone who has ever competed.

Reading this page: a single is one solve's time · an average is the middle three of five solves, best and worst discarded · a PB is a personal best · a DNF (did not finish) is an attempt with no valid result: a popped piece, an unsolved face, an over-limit memorisation · top X% compares against everyone ever ranked in that event, which is fairer than raw rank because event pools differ tenfold.
